The nightlife scene is
well and truly alive in
Phuket and particularly in
Patong
where you will find the majority of the bars and clubs.
Here you will witness the craziness of
Bangla Road, with
thumping loud music and bars and clubs all lit up.
From late afternoon till the sun comes up, Bangla Road is
closed off to the traffic and becomes a walking street and
its party time and every night of the week is like a
Saturday night, all year round.
Bangla Road has many Soi's or side streets running off the road
and expect to be hassled to enter the bars or clubs walking
down any of these to enter a bar, a nightclub, or to see a
show.
There are Beer Bars, Go Go Bars, Night Clubs, Discos, Live
Music Venues, Sports Pubs, Cabaret Shows, and Karaoke Bars
in Bangla and you are spoilt for choice as all these venues
are located all right next to each other.

Bars: There are too many bars in
Patong to name them all and there are some different types
of bars, to keep all kinds of tourists entertained. Most of
the bars cater for single males of all ages and employ
women to keep them entertained. The
Aussie
Bar, located about half way down Bangla Road,
is a favourite place for Aussie's to have a drin and the bar
is one of the largest in Bangla Road and you can't miss it
when you walk past as it is so big. There are many other smaller bars all
around Patong with most of them being very small open air
bars, which are located right next to other competing bars,
especially in Bangla Road. The Kangaroo Bar, the Honky Tonk Bar
and P-One, are also very popular bars on Bangla.
Beer Bars: These bars are
everywhere in Bangla Road and are basically a bar that employs pretty
girls known as bar girls to stand out the front trying to lure customers
inside to drink at the bar or keep them there by
entertaining them.
Once you enter the bar, you will more than likely be asked
to play connect four, the jackpot game, or hammer the nail
into a piece of wood. When plying these games, don't play
for drinks because you will most likely lose. Remember
these girls play these games every night and have had a lot
of practice, so don't waste your money on
this.
The best option is the jackpot game, because its simply a game of
rolling 2 dice to match the numbers on the top of the panel, and its all
luck. You can actually score yourself free drinks playing the jackpot
game.
For a small fee known as a bar fine, the
bar girl can be
relieved of her duties at the bar and is allowed to go with
anyone she wants. The prices of the bar fines vary but are
usually around 300 to 500 Baht.

Nightclubs and Discos
Patong has quite a few decent nightclubs and discos with
loud pumping sound systems and the occasional
international dj. The clubs here have a mixture of Thai
people (mostly females) and tourists from all over the
world.
Hollywood:
Plays mostly hip hop and electro music every night and this is a favourite
place for the Thai girls to have a dance and it is jam
packed every night of the week. Hollywood has quality
lighting and a really good sound system and the management here know
what they are doing as they put on ladies nights and prizes and
extra free drinks to keep the women coming back every night. You can expect to be
approached by many friendly ladies when you are in this
club. Hollywood is open till very late and it really gets going after
2 am.
Tiger:
Is also a hot spot for the Thai girls, here they
pump out a mixture of dance music from house to hip hop
and electro. Its big and gets a large crowd here,
especially later on in the night. The women are not shy
here either.
Seduction:
Is more popular among the tourists but you will still see
many Thai women here. Seduction often has well known international dj's playing and 2 floors of quality
thumping sound systems pumping out hip hop and
house.
Banana Disco: Is on the main beach road around the
corner from Bangla Road and is an older
club that has been around for a while. The disco is more
suited to an older tourist crowd.
Tai Pan:
Located on Rat U Thit Road, strait across the road
from Bangla. The club has a mixture of djs and live
bands with the bands playing early in the night and dj's
later on in the night.
Baya Beach: A smaller club situated
right between Tai Pan and Rock City and is pretty popular
with both the tourists and the Thai girls. It is known to
get busy here after 2.00am and is often still open until
daylight.
Factory
Bar: One of the newer clubs to hit the
scene. This club has a slightly open air setting with a
large bar and views over
Bangla Road. The club plays hip
hop, dance music and classic hits. There are also regular
bikini shows.
Famous:
The newest club in
Phuket which is located where Sound
Club used to be. Some world class dj's have played here
and it is the place to be if you are into dance music.
Famous has a beach club and a rooftop swimming pool
which has a clear bottom which you can look up into from the
nightclub or down into the nightclub. The club is very popular with
Russian tourists.

Live Music Venues: There are some live
music venues particularly where the end of Bangla Road,
meets Rat U Thit Road. Margaritas, Rock
City and
Tai Pan are the main
venues for live bands which play throughout the night.
Sports Pubs: The name pretty much says
it all, pubs with big screens in them where you can enjoy
a drink and watch your favourite sport. They have live
satellite viewing from around the world with soccer,
racing, rugby and rugby league.
Pubs: There are your usual pubs here
too, which also show some sports events when they are
available and have the typical things in them that most
pubs have, such as - pool, darts, etc. Many of these pubs
are also part restaurant.
Cabaret Shows: Surprisingly enough,
people like to go and see these shows, where
transvestites (Lady Boys) dress up and put on a show.
Here you can see Thai men who look a lot like ladies and put
on a colourful display.

Karaoke Bars: There are a few karaoke
bars in the Bangla Road area, most of them have a band
with live music that you can sing along to. These bars
cater mostly for the older crowds and play older styles
of music.
Most of the karaoke places outside of the Bangla Road
area
cater for Thai people and play mostly Thai songs, which
no westerner would know. As a westerner at one of these
places, listening to people sing Thai love songs can be
torture.
Thai Boxing: You only have to be in Patong
for not even a day when you would have heard the
annoying voices coming out of a loudspeaker of a ute -
repeating the same things over and over, trying to
promote the Thai Boxing. The boxing at Bangla
Boxing Stadium, is fake which some tourists
either don't know about or don't really care and just
want to see a good show. The real boxing is at
Patong Boxing Stadium. Here you will see fights for real titles.

Nightlife in Other Phuket Areas
Karon: There are a number of bars here
and even some beer bars. Most of the bars here are
concentrated in and near the area known as The Circle.
Some people prefer the laid back feel of
Karon over
places like Patong.
Kata: Has a similar nightlife scene to
Karon
and has many bars all located together at the
northern end with plenty of
bar girls around and the
occasional bar here and there in other areas of Kata.
Surin Beach: Has some bars located near
or on the beach and a well known nightclub and bar called
-
Stereo
Lab. Djs here play a range of dance music
such as - house, hip hop, breaks and lounge music and the
occasional international dj has been known to drop in to
spin a few tunes from time to time.
Phuket Town: Most clubs and bars here
cater for Thai people, with places that are filled with
locals having a good time dancing to there favourite
tunes or singing Karaoke. Tourists have been known to go
out in Phuket Town too, but its a bit of a hike to get
here for a night out if you are staying on the western
side of the island.
There are many places in
Phuket Town to sing Karaoke, but
as mentioned before, it can be quiet boring for any
westerner who doesn't know any of the Thai songs or
language.
